Major and Lieutenant Colonel level Army officers would be cross-posted to the IAF and Navy, with a similar number of IAF and Navy officers slated to be deployed to Army institutions for similar roles, according to top authorities. The First Batch of Women Officers was Commissioned into the Regiment of Artillery of the Indian Army. Five Women Officers today joined the Regiment of Artillery after the successful completion of training at the Officers Training Academy (OTA), Chennai. The Acceptance of Necessity (AoN) for 307 Advanced Towed Artillery Gun Systems (ATAGS) was recently accepted by the Defence Acquisition Council, overseen by the Union defence minister. The Indian Army said on Saturday that it has foiled another effort to disrupt the G20 conference and cause disruption in the Valley by blocking an infiltration bid along the Line of Control (LoC) in north Kashmir’s Uri sector.
